The Benefits of Using Online Tools to Create UML Diagrams

UML (Unified Modeling Language) diagrams are essential for software developers and system architects to visually represent the structure and behavior of a system. Traditionally, creating UML diagrams required specialized software installed on a computer. However, with the advent of online tools, creating UML diagrams has become easier and more accessible than ever before. In this article, we will explore the benefits of using online tools to create UML diagrams.

Convenience and Accessibility

One of the primary advantages of using online tools to create UML diagrams is the convenience and accessibility they offer. With traditional software, you would need to install it on your computer, which may not always be feasible or practical. Online tools eliminate the need for installation by providing a platform that can be accessed through a web browser from any device with an internet connection.

This convenience allows you to work on your UML diagrams from anywhere at any time. Whether you are at home, in the office, or even on the go, all you need is a device with internet access to start creating or editing your UML diagrams. This accessibility ensures that you can collaborate with team members regardless of their physical location, making it easier than ever to work together on complex projects.

Cost-Effectiveness

Another significant benefit of using online tools for creating UML diagrams is their cost-effectiveness. Traditional software often comes with hefty price tags that may not be affordable for individuals or small businesses. On the other hand, many online tools offer free plans with basic features that can be sufficient for most users’ needs.

Additionally, online tools usually provide subscription-based pricing models that allow you to scale up or down as per your requirements. This flexibility enables you to choose a plan that suits your budget and only pay for the features and functionalities that are essential for your specific use case.

Collaboration and Sharing

Collaboration is an essential aspect of software development and system architecture. Online UML diagram tools excel in this area by providing features that allow multiple users to work on the same diagram simultaneously. This real-time collaboration eliminates the need for manual merging of changes and ensures that all team members are always up to date with the latest version of the diagram.

Furthermore, online tools make it easy to share your UML diagrams with others. You can simply generate a shareable link or export the diagram in various formats such as PDF or image files. This capability facilitates seamless communication and feedback exchange between team members, stakeholders, and clients.

Integration and Extensibility

Online UML diagram tools often offer integration with other software and services, making them even more powerful and versatile. For example, you may be able to integrate your UML diagrams with project management tools, version control systems, or documentation platforms. This integration streamlines your workflow by eliminating manual data transfer between different applications.

Additionally, some online tools provide extensibility through plugins or APIs (Application Programming Interfaces). These extensions allow you to customize the tool’s functionalities according to your specific requirements or integrate it with your existing software ecosystem.

In conclusion, using online tools for creating UML diagrams offers several benefits such as convenience, accessibility, cost-effectiveness, collaboration capabilities, sharing options, integration possibilities, and extensibility. By leveraging these advantages, software developers and system architects can streamline their processes and enhance their productivity while creating accurate visual representations of complex systems.

This text was generated using a large language model, and select text has been reviewed and moderated for purposes such as readability.